What companies run services between Libeň, Hlavní město Praha, Czechia and Prague Airport Terminal 1/2, Czechia?

RegioJet operates a bus from Praha, ÚAN Florenc to Prague Airport Terminal 1/2 hourly. Tickets cost Kč 102 and the journey takes 30 min. FlixBus also services this route every 4 hours.
